Output e1c3fbcfc81feb80da8027cc091819752e0737bcb91ff0849d7266bab235c2c7:27

value
696530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72a67f5bd9541429f3b0df9fced8bd13ec63d3fe OP_EQUAL
address
3C9EQruLBx3ubTGDwRHKkPaVvnFyxztc7U
transaction
e1c3fbcfc81feb80da8027cc091819752e0737bcb91ff0849d7266bab235c2c7
confirmations
171019
spent
true